Main issues, as the Inspector framed them
- whether the proposed development is consistent with, and authorised by, the terms of the outline planning permission
- the effect of the proposed development on the character and appearance of the area
- whether the proposed development would provide satisfactory living conditions for future occupiers with particular regard to external amenity space
- whether the proposed development would be likely to have a significant effect on the integrity of the Ramsar
- whether the proposed development would cause unacceptable harm to the safety of users of Longstrings Lane
What decided it
The proposed Orchard Store did not form part of the outline planning permission and therefore the reserved matters application was not authorised by the outline permission.
